如何设计高效智能对话流程与脚本
在当今这个信息爆炸的时代,人工智能技术已经深入到我们生活的方方面面。其中,智能对话系统作为一种新兴的人工智能应用,正逐渐成为人们获取信息、解决问题的重要途径。如何设计高效智能对话流程与脚本,成为了许多企业和开发者关注的焦点。本文将讲述一位资深AI对话系统设计师的故事,分享他在设计高效智能对话流程与脚本方面的经验和心得。
这位设计师名叫李明,从事AI对话系统设计工作已有5年。他曾在多个知名企业担任过AI对话系统设计师,积累了丰富的实践经验。在李明的职业生涯中,他参与设计了许多优秀的智能对话系统,这些系统在金融、教育、医疗等多个领域都取得了显著的应用成果。
一、了解用户需求,明确对话目标
在设计智能对话流程与脚本之前,首先要了解用户的需求。李明认为,了解用户需求是设计高效智能对话流程与脚本的关键。他通常会通过以下几种方式来了解用户需求:
用户调研:通过问卷调查、访谈等方式,收集用户在使用对话系统时的痛点、需求和建议。
竞品分析:分析市场上现有的智能对话系统,了解它们的优缺点,为设计提供参考。
业务需求分析:与业务部门沟通,了解业务场景、用户行为和对话目标。
通过以上方式,李明能够明确对话目标,为设计高效智能对话流程与脚本奠定基础。
二、构建对话流程,优化用户体验
在明确对话目标后,李明会开始构建对话流程。他通常会遵循以下步骤:
设计对话场景:根据业务需求和用户需求,设计出符合实际场景的对话场景。
确定对话节点:将对话场景分解为若干个节点,每个节点对应一个对话任务。
设计对话路径:根据对话节点,设计出多条对话路径,以应对不同的用户输入。
优化用户体验:在对话流程中,关注用户体验,确保对话过程流畅、自然。
以下是一个简单的对话流程示例:
场景:用户想了解一款理财产品的收益情况。
节点1:用户询问理财产品收益情况。
路径1:系统回答理财产品收益情况。
路径2:系统询问用户对收益情况的要求。
节点2:用户对收益情况的要求。
路径1:系统根据用户要求,推荐符合要求的理财产品。
路径2:系统询问用户是否需要了解其他信息。
通过以上步骤,李明能够构建出高效、流畅的对话流程,为用户提供优质的对话体验。
三、设计对话脚本,提升对话质量
在构建对话流程的基础上,李明会开始设计对话脚本。以下是他在设计对话脚本时的一些心得:
逻辑清晰:对话脚本要逻辑清晰,确保用户能够快速理解对话内容。
语言简洁:使用简洁、易懂的语言,避免使用过于专业或复杂的词汇。
个性化:根据用户需求和场景,设计个性化的对话内容,提升用户体验。
适应性:对话脚本要具备一定的适应性,能够应对不同用户输入。
以下是一个简单的对话脚本示例:
用户:我想了解这款理财产品的收益情况。
系统:您好,很高兴为您服务。这款理财产品的年化收益率为5%,您是否满意?
用户:5%的年化收益率有点低,我想了解一下其他产品的收益情况。
系统:好的,根据您的需求,我为您推荐了以下几款理财产品:产品A(年化收益率6%)、产品B(年化收益率7%)、产品C(年化收益率8%)。您对哪款产品更感兴趣呢?
通过以上设计,李明能够确保对话质量,提升用户满意度。
四、持续优化,提升对话系统性能
在设计完智能对话流程与脚本后,李明会进行持续优化,以提升对话系统的性能。以下是他的一些优化方法:
数据分析:通过分析用户对话数据,了解用户行为和需求,为优化提供依据。
A/B测试:对不同版本的对话流程与脚本进行A/B测试,找出最优方案。
不断迭代:根据用户反馈和业务需求,不断迭代优化对话系统。
通过以上方法,李明能够确保智能对话系统始终保持高效、智能的状态。
总之,设计高效智能对话流程与脚本需要深入了解用户需求、构建合理的对话流程、设计优质的对话脚本,并持续优化。李明通过多年的实践经验,为我们提供了宝贵的经验和启示。在人工智能技术不断发展的今天,相信越来越多的开发者能够设计出更加优秀的智能对话系统,为人们的生活带来更多便利。
猜你喜欢:AI语音开发套件